B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a backpack-type working machine, and more particularly to a mounting structure for mounting an engine main body to a backpack-carrying platform in a vibration-insulated state in the backpack-type working machine.

2. Description of the Related Art There are known backpack-type working machines such as brush cutters in which an engine body is mounted as a power source on a backpack frame carried by a worker. It has a structure in which it is attached to a backpack mount via a mounting structure having members. With such a conventional structure,
When an operator tilts or shakes the backpack while he is working, the engine body tilts or sways significantly, and the force generated by it is transmitted to the shoulders of the worker through the backpack, which causes a considerable amount of work to the worker. However, there is a drawback that the vibration damping member is easily damaged. As a countermeasure against this, the utility model No. 50-26014 and the utility model No. 50-1592
No. 8, JP-A-60-101394, etc., it has been proposed to attach the upper and lower parts of the engine body to the backpack mount via vibration-proof members, but the stability is poor and the vibration-proof properties are sufficient. There were drawbacks such as not.

SUMMARY OF THE INVENTION It is therefore an object of the present invention to eliminate the above-mentioned drawbacks of the prior art and to provide a simple and convenient backpack type working machine.

According to the present invention, in a backpack-type working machine including a backpack mount and an engine body mounted on the backpack mount, a bottom mounting for mounting the bottom portion of the engine body to the backpack mount. And a top mounting structure for mounting the top of the engine body to the backpack mount, each of the bottom mounting structure and the top mounting structure has a vibration damping mechanism including a vibration damping rubber, and the bottom mounting structure is The engine mounting base is attached to the backpack mount via a plurality of vibration isolation mechanisms.

DESCRIPTION OF THE PREFERRED EMBODIMENTS Next, a backpack type working machine according to the present invention will be described with reference to the drawings. FIG. 1 is a schematic side view of a power unit of a backpack-type brush cutter as an embodiment of the present invention, and FIG.
It is an expanded sectional view of the part enclosed by the circle A. A backpack frame 1 (a backpack band or the like is omitted) carried by an operator has a substantially L-shape, and a bottom portion 2 of an engine body 4 is mounted on a foot portion 26 thereof via a bottom portion mounting structure 3. There is. The bottom mounting structure 3 is fixed at its lower end to the foot portion 26 of the backrest mount 1, and is, for example, 1 around the vertical axis OO.
Three anti-vibration mechanisms 5 and 6, 6 arranged at intervals of 20 degrees
And a base 7 attached to the bottom of the engine body 4 is attached to a bearing portion 25 provided at the center of the base 7 coaxially with the axis O-O. The main body 4 is mounted so as to be rotatable in the horizontal direction. Further, the engine body 4 has its top portion 11 attached to an upper portion 9 of the backpack mount 1 via an upper mounting structure 8. The upper attachment structure 8 is a bracket whose one end is fixed to the upper portion 9 of the backpack mount 1. 10 and a vibration isolation mechanism 12 mounted between the other end of the bracket 10 and the top 11 of the engine body 4.
And Anti-vibration mechanism 5, 6, 6 of the bottom mounting structure 3
Since any material having an appropriate structure such as a coil spring may be used, only the vibration isolation mechanism 12 of the upper mounting structure 8 will be described in more detail.

The vibration isolating mechanism 12 of the upper mounting structure 8 has vibration isolating rubbers 15 having end members 13 and 14 fixed to the upper and lower ends thereof as shown in FIG.
It is fixed to the cylinder 27 via a screw receiving portion 22 provided at a position through which the axis O-O of the top portion 11 of the engine body 4 is passed by a screw 16 protruding from 4. The upper end member 13 has a screw hole 17 coaxial with the bearing OO opened upward, and a bolt 18 is screwed into the screw hole 17 from above. The bolt 18 is a bearing bush 20 rotatably fitted into a bearing guide cylinder 21 fixed to a hole 19 coaxial with the axis O-O formed at the other end of the bracket 10 of the backpack mount 1. Then, the upper end member 13 is fixed to the bracket 10 by penetrating the protective cap 28 that covers these parts. In addition, the upper end member 1
An engaging recess 23 for a rotation preventing tool is formed in the third portion, the lower end member 14 is cup-shaped, and the outer periphery thereof is formed with a parallel chamfered wrench hook portion (not shown). Therefore, it is preferable that the antivibration rubber 15 is not twisted when the antivibration mechanism 12 is attached or detached. When the cylinder cover or the like forming the top portion 11 of the engine body 4 is made of synthetic resin, the screw receiving portion 22 is made of a heat insulating material such as Bakelite and the reinforcing ring 24 is inserted thereinto. It is possible to prevent the heat from being transferred from the cylinder 27 to the like and prevent the melting accident of the cover and the like. In this way, the bottom mounting structure 3 and the upper mounting structure 8 cooperate to make the engine body 4 rotatable about the axis O-O, and transmit the vibration to the backpack mount 1. To prevent excessive tilting and rolling of the engine body 4.

[Effects of the Invention] With the configuration of the present invention described above, the present invention effectively reduces vibration during use, and reliably prevents excessive tilting and cornering of the engine body during work. The rotation of the engine body is smooth, and the load on each mounting structure at the time of starting the recoil can be reduced.
